The Naval Ship Design Graduate Certificate at George Mason University is crafted to equip students with fundamental knowledge and practical experience in the art of naval ship design and management. The program combines coursework and experiential learning to help students become effective ship designers and design managers. Graduates will learn to design vessels for specific mission profiles, evaluate design decisions' impact on operations, and translate fleet requirements into cost-managed design specifications.

The certificate requires the completion of 15 credits, including four core courses—Naval Engineering, Fundamentals of Naval Architecture, Ship Design Process and Tools, and Naval Project Management—each worth 3 credits. Students must also take one elective course from a list of approved options, which include courses on energy transfer, fluid mechanics, material properties, and more. The program is flexible for both full-time and part-time students.

Graduates of this certificate can pursue careers in naval architecture, ship design, and engineering management. They will have the skills to support design programs, assess vessel design impacts, and collaborate on fleet requirements—valuable roles within defense organizations, maritime industries, and engineering firms.
